French Piracy Blocking Order Goes Global, DNS Service Quad9 Vows to Fight


Canal+ has secured court orders compelling DNS providers Quad9 and Vercara to block access to pirate streaming sites.

In May, the Paris Judicial Court ordered Google, Cloudflare, and Cisco to block access to several pirate websites by poisoning their DNS. Applicant Canal+ argued that the alternative DNS resolvers allowed people to bypass the “regular” blocking measures implemented by internet providers. “We will appeal this ruling, but until the courts find in favor of our arguments we must maintain the list of blocked sites,” the company adds.
